How Reliable is the Kia Sedona?

Based on 571,888 MOT tests across 40,502 vehicles.

67.7%
Pass Rate
7,120
Miles/Year
26
Year Lifespan
40,502
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Parking brake: efficiency below requirements 34,279
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 32,426
Brake pipe excessively corroded 27,555
parking brake recording little or no effort 26,462
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 16,446

YJ11 KPY is a 2011 Kia Sedona in Black with a 2,199c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70%.

Across all 2011 Kia Sedona models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.0% with a typical mileage of 59,348 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Kia Sedona f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 34,279 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YJ11 KPY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Kia Sedona typ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 15 years old, this Kia Sedona is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
